When it comes to building a potent Chevy 350 engine, one of the key questions enthusiasts ask is: How much horsepower can a 2-bolt main 350 reliably handle? This is crucial for anyone aiming to get the most out of their engine without risking failure or damage. Rest assured, I’m here to provide you with detailed, accurate insights on this topic to help you make informed decisions.

The short answer: A stock 2-bolt main Chevrolet 350 engine typically handles between 350 to 400 horsepower safely with stock components, but with modifications and proper tuning, it can support up to 500-550 horsepower. Pushing beyond this range requires upgrades to internals and supporting systems to ensure reliability.

Understanding the 2-Bolt Main 350 Engine

The Chevrolet 350 cubic inch V8 — a true classic — has been a favorite among muscle car enthusiasts, hot-rodders, and builders for decades. Its 2-bolt main configuration refers to the number of bolts securing the crankshaft to the engine block, which directly impacts the engine’s strength and reliability under higher power loads.

What is a 2-Bolt Main?

  • Definition: A 2-bolt main engine features two bolts per main cap securing the crankshaft. It’s the most common configuration in earlier Chevy small-blocks.
  • Strengths: Adequate for stock or mildly modified engines; simple design, easier to work on.
  • Limitations: Less robust under high-horsepower demands compared to 4-bolt mains, especially in high-RPM or high-torque applications.

Why Does Main Cap Count Matter?

The main caps hold the crankshaft in place. More bolts (like 4-bolt mains) generally mean better strength and durability in high-performance builds. However, many stock and lightly modified 2-bolt mains provide sufficient strength if properly maintained and tuned.


How Much HP Can a 2-Bolt Main 350 Handle?

Stock 2-bolt main 350 engines are typically rated for about 350 horsepower in factory form. However, the actual safe horsepower limit depends on several factors:

Component TypeStock LimitModified LimitRemarks
Base 2-bolt 350~350 HPUp to 400 HPWith stock internals
Mildly Upgraded 350400-450 HPUp to 500 HPBetter pistons, cam, and intake
Performance 350 (with internal upgrades)500-550 HP550+ HPForged internals, stronger crank, better heads

Key Factors Influencing Power Limits:

  • Internals quality: Cast pistons vs. forged pistons
  • Compression ratio: Higher ratios generate more power but increase stress
  • Camshaft profile: Performance camshafts can increase power significantly
  • Fuel system: Proper fueling ensures safe operation at high power
  • Cooling system: Keeps engine temps within safe limits

Real-World Limits

Many experienced builders report that a well-maintained, mildly upgraded 2-bolt main 350 can reliably produce around 400–450 horsepower. Going beyond this range typically requires internal upgrades, reinforced components, and precise tuning.


Critical Upgrades for Increased Horsepower

To safely push beyond the stock limits, consider these upgrades:

Internals Enhancement

  • Forged Pistons: Handle higher compression and stress.
  • Steel or Forged Crankshaft: More durable under high torque.
  • Heavy-Duty Connecting Rods: Minimize flex and failure at high RPM.
  • Performance Valve Springs: Prevent valve float.

Supporting Systems

  • Upgraded Carburetor/EFI: Optimize air-fuel delivery.
  • High-Flow Heads: Improve airflow, increase power.
  • Better Intake Manifolds: Maximize volumetric efficiency.
  • Exhaust System: Larger headers and free-flowing exhaust to match power output.

Tuning & Testing

  • Use a dynamometer to monitor real power output.
  • Properly set fuel mixture and timing.
  • Regular maintenance to prevent failures.

Common Mistakes & How to Avoid Them

MistakeConsequencesHow to Avoid
Overestimating stock internalsEngine failure, blown pistons/crankUpgrade internals for high HP builds
Ignoring cooling needsOverheating and damageInstall upgraded radiators, oil coolers
Under-tuning or improper fuelingDetonation, engine knockProper dyno tuning and quality fuel
Not reinforcing crankshaftCrank failure at high powerSwitch to forged crank in high-power setups

Similar Variations & Alternatives

  • 4-Bolt Main Engines: Offer higher durability and power handling capabilities.
  • Hollebore or stroke modifications: Increase displacement and torque.
  • Big Block swaps: For serious horsepower and torque gains.
  • EFI conversions: More precise fuel management for high horsepower builds.
